JAMES V. SELNA, District Judge.
On August 30, 2018, this Court issued an order granting Defendant New Penn Financial, LLC d/b/a Shellpoint Mortgage Servicing's Motion for Summary Judgment ("Motion") against Plaintiffs Mohammad Redjai and Shahin Redjai's ("Plaintiffs") Complaint. See Dkt. 91. In addition, on August 27, 2018 at the hearing on the Motion, the Court granted Plaintiffs' oral motion to dismiss, with prejudice, Defendant the Bank of New York Mellon fka The Bank of New York, as Trustee for the Certificateholders of the CWALT, Inc., Alternative Loan Trust 2006-HY10 Mortgage Pass-Through Certificates, Series 2006-HY10's (collectively, "Defendants"). See Dkt. 87.
Pursuant to the Court's Order, and for good cause shown, IT IS HEREBY ORDERED, ADJUDGED AND DECREED that:
1. The entire action is dismissed with prejudice;
2. Plaintiffs shall take nothing as to Defendants;
3. Judgment shall be entered in favor of Defendants and against Plaintiffs;
4. If Plaintiffs have recorded a lis pendens, it shall be and hereby is expunged, and Defendants may record this judgment with the County Recorder as evidence of said expungement; and
5. Defendants may recover costs from Plaintiffs as permitted by law.
